Specifications of ARS34Y12

Relay Type
RF
Circuit
SPDT (1 Form C)
Contact Rating @ Voltage
0.5A @ 30VDC
Coil Type
Standard
Coil Current
16.7mA
Coil Voltage
12VDC
Control On Voltage (max)
9 VDC
Control Off Voltage (min)
1.2 VDC
Mounting Type
Surface Mount
Termination Style
Gull Wing
Lead Free Status / RoHS Status
Lead free / RoHS Compliant
